Akshaya Patra’s Support during COVID-19 2.0

covid19 relief fund

The Akshaya Patra Foundation began its COVID-19 relief services on 25th March 2020 by providing freshly cooked meals, grocery kits and Happiness Kits to thousands of people by coordinating with various State Governments & District Administrations. Around 12-crore cumulative meals were served and distributed to people from marginalised sections of the society.

The NGO supporting during COVID-19 adheres to safety and hygiene measures while serving cooked food and while distributing kits in Rajasthan, Karnataka, Telangana, Gujarat, Maharashtra, NCR, Uttar Pradesh, Andhra Pradesh, Tamil Nadu, Chhattisgarh, Odisha, Assam, Madhya Pradesh, Uttarakhand, Tripura, West Bengal, Punjab, Jharkhand and Himachal Pradesh.

Just when all of us began to accept the new guidelines that were accepted as norms, the 2nd wave of the pandemic hit us again! And this time, it hit us even harder. Akshaya Patra continues with all its might to feed the needy people during the second wave too.

“Krishna, The Infinite” – an Aura Art Online Art Sale in support of Akshaya Patra

akshaya patra

An online art show titled “Krishna – The Infinite”, which featured over 100 paintings and sculptures of over 50 artists, was launched by Aura Art eConnect Pvt. Ltd, in support of The Akshaya Patra Foundation’s various initiatives. An art connoisseur and curater Aura Art, fills gaps in the Indian Art Industry by promoting Indian Art and artists all over India. A portion of the proceeds will be donated by Aura Art to The Akshaya Patra Foundation.

The art show was hosted by Akshaya Patra on 27th February 2021. This sale was on until 14th March 2021. At the virtual launch, the Chief Guest was MasterChef Padma Shri Sanjeev Kapoor and the Guest of Honour was Rotarian Sandip Agarwalla (DGN 2022-23, Rotary International District 3141). Other dignitaries present at this rare online art show launch were Mr. Shridhar Venkat (CEO, The Akshaya Patra Foundation), Mr Sundeep Talwar (CMO, The Akshaya Patra Foundation) and Mr Rishiraj Sethi (Director, Aura Art eConnect Pvt Ltd).
